A 40-year-old man living in a slum with heavy louse infestation presents with his third febrile episode in 3 weeks, each lasting 3 to 5 days with intervening afebrile periods. During a febrile spike, a Giemsa-stained peripheral blood smear shows loosely coiled spirochaetes in the plasma between red cells. What is the causative organism and its mode of transmission?
- A Leptospira interrogans, contact with contaminated water
- B Treponema pallidum, sexual contact
- C Borrelia burgdorferi, Ixodes tick
- D Borrelia recurrentis, human body louse ✓
Explanation
Louse-borne relapsing fever is caused by Borrelia recurrentis and is transmitted by the human body louse Pediculus humanus corporis. Unlike other borreliae, D. recurrentis has no animal reservoir and humans are the sole host. Spirochaetaemia is highest during the febrile phase, making Giemsa or dark-field examination of peripheral blood during fever the diagnostic method of choice. Antigenic variation of outer surface proteins explains the recurrent episodes, a mechanism already tested elsewhere, so this item focuses on diagnosis and vector.
